The Scenic Route and Highlights

As you glide out of the marina, your guides will start sharing insights about Lagos’s history and geography. We loved how the commentary was friendly and engaging, making the scenery even more meaningful. The tour visits several notable beaches, including Praia da Batata and Praia dos Estudantes—both iconic spots with their charming vibes and historical significance.

Passing along the coast, you’ll see Pinhão Beach, Dona Ana Beach, and Camilo Beach—each unique, with Dona Ana being especially renowned for its picturesque cliffs and clear waters. The boat then maneuvers towards Ponta da Piedade, where the real spectacle begins.

Exploring the Cave Formations

The highlight of the tour is the exploration of Ponta da Piedade’s famous rock formations. Some of these formations have names that evoke their shapes or stories: Chaminé, Titanic, Bay of the Elephant, Arc of Triumph, Kitchen, Garage, Room, Cathedral, Corridor, Head of the Horse, and The Pirate’s Head. These whimsical names reflect the fascinating shapes the waves have carved into the cliffs over centuries.
